What happened
OpenAI has officially begun displaying Kalshi's World Cup prediction market odds within ChatGPT search results. This integration marks OpenAI's first collaboration with a regulated betting exchange, highlighting a significant step in merging AI technology with real-time betting information. Users can now access up-to-date odds for World Cup matches directly through the AI interface.
The partnership was first reported by The New York Times, and the odds displayed will be labeled with "Source: Kalshi." However, the integration does not include outbound links to Kalshi, keeping the user experience contained within ChatGPT.
